Is there anyway to type words onto screen during presentation?

Lynda - 15 May 2008 12:04 GMT
I know how to a pen and highlighter durign a presentation but sometimes it
would be handy during feedback to type on screen and be able to save slide
without going out of show view and back to slide view...any ideas gratefully
received
John Wilson - 15 May 2008 12:42 GMT
Hi Lynda

You can do this be adding a control text box

There are several tutorials out there including one on our site
